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Improve filter presentation #659

Open
BulotF opened this issue Feb 20, 2023 · 0 comments
Open

Improve filter presentation #659

BulotF opened this issue Feb 20, 2023 · 0 comments
Labels
Area: Refonte P3 ticket pour le refonte Pogues Type: Feature New feature for Bowie applications

Comments

@BulotF
Copy link
Contributor

BulotF commented Feb 20, 2023

Les filtres sont présentés tous sur une même ligne. Lorsque certains d'entre eux ont des conditions ne permettant pas le passage à la ligne, les boutons de fin de ligne sortent du cadre.
Beaucoup de filtres ne portent que sur une seule question, donc la condition du filtre apparaît 2 fois sur la question, la rendant moins lisible.

Propositions :

  • Avoir un nouvel élément en plus de "Si" et "Fin si" pour désigner un filtre présent dans les 2 listes et ainsi alléger l'IHM en supprimant le doublon
  • Répartir les filtres sur 3 colonnes :
    • Fin si (si possible, trié en ordre inverse des créations pour rapprocher au maximum les début et fin des filtres qui concernent peu de questions)
    • Si/Fin Si
    • Si

N.B. Normalement, les 1° et 3° colonnes sont exclusives, car leur présence commune est le signe d'un chevauchement entre files

Ceci améliorerait la lisibilité en limitant l'information disponible.
On pourrait aussi personnaliser la CSS des cadres : plein pour Si/Fin Si ; 2 types de pointillés différents pour Si et Fin Si. Le type de participation de la question au filtre se verrait donc aussi sans lire le début de la condition.

@AnneHuSKa AnneHuSKa added Area: Refonte P3 ticket pour le refonte Pogues ux labels Oct 2, 2024
@JulienCarmona JulienCarmona added the Type: Feature New feature for Bowie applications label Oct 11, 2024
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
Area: Refonte P3 ticket pour le refonte Pogues Type: Feature New feature for Bowie applications
Projects
None yet
Development

No branches or pull requests

3 participants